Biden DHS Declares Terrorism Threat Due to ‘False and Misleading Narratives’ and ‘Conspiracy Theories’ Online

Joe Biden’s Department of Homeland Security (DHS) declared a heightened terrorism threat due to “several factors, including an online environment filled with false or misleading narratives and conspiracy theories.”

In other words, any speech or opinions of which the DHS doesn’t approve is now a “terrorism threat.”

Read the tyrannical DHS National Terrorism Advisory System bulletin released on Monday:

The United States remains in a heightened threat environment fueled by several factors, including an online environment filled with false or misleading narratives and conspiracy theories, and other forms of mis- dis- and mal-information (MDM) introduced and/or amplified by foreign and domestic threat actors.

These threat actors seek to exacerbate societal friction to sow discord and undermine public trust in government institutions to encourage unrest, which could potentially inspire acts of violence. Mass casualty attacks and other acts of targeted violence conducted by lone offenders and small groups acting in furtherance of ideological beliefs and/or personal grievances pose an ongoing threat to the nation.

While the conditions underlying the heightened threat landscape have not significantly changed over the last year, the convergence of the following factors has increased the volatility, unpredictability, and complexity of the threat environment: (1) the proliferation of false or misleading narratives, which sow discord or undermine public trust in U.S. government institutions; (2) continued calls for violence directed at U.S. critical infrastructure; soft targets and mass gatherings; faith-based institutions, such as churches, synagogues, and mosques; institutions of higher education; racial and religious minorities; government facilities and personnel, including law enforcement and the military; the media; and perceived ideological opponents; and (3) calls by foreign terrorist organizations for attacks on the United States based on recent events.

In response to these major “threats” of unsanctioned speech, the DHS said it’s “working with public and private sector partners, as well as foreign counterparts, to identify and evaluate MDM, including false or misleading narratives and conspiracy theories spread on social media and other online platforms that endorse or could inspire violence.”

Serial Rapist Cop, Sentenced to 263 Years, Up for Parole After Doing Just 6 Years

A disgraced former Oklahoma City police officer, Daniel Holtzclaw, 29, was sentenced to 263 years in prison in 2016, after being convicted of numerous rapes and sexual assaults while on duty. Holtzclaw was convicted on 18 felony counts — including four counts of first-degree rape in December, 2015.

After serving a portion of this sentence, Holtzclaw appealed, maintaining his innocent since the beginning. In 2019, Holtzclaw tried to appeal the case, however, the evidence against him is so overwhelming, a judge refused to overturn his conviction.

The Oklahoma Court of Criminal Appeals in August 2019 upheld the convictions of Holtzclaw. On Monday, however, Holtzclaw once again tried to get out of jail, getting yet another chance before Oklahoma Pardon and Parole Board. Luckily for his victims, once again, he was denied in a 5-0 vote.

Holtzclaw and his family have maintained his innocence since day one and claim that because the judge in his case, Oklahoma County District Judge Tim Henderson, was accused of sexual misconduct himself, that Holtzclaw must have been railroaded.

“I hope and pray more people finally see I truly was railroaded and wrongfully convicted,” he said in a statement. “I upheld my oath of office by protecting and serving my community, while Judge Henderson was allegedly abusing women and violating his oath. It’s time to reopen every one of Henderson’s cases, including mine, that was impacted by his sexual misconduct.”

Police Threaten Arrests For People Giving Fuel to Freedom Convoy

Ottawa police have threatened to arrest anyone providing the Freedom Convoy with gas and diesel cans after they initially blocked trucks with fuel tanks coming to the aid of the protesters.

Authorities announced that anyone providing “material support” to the demonstrators would be subject to arrest from midnight last night.

Asked whether “material support” included necessities like food and water, a police spokesperson told Fox News that the announcement “relates to hazardous materials that represent a public safety or fire hazard.”

Videos soon emerged of people being arrested and police seizing fuel from protesters.
